Quick Brief

The Department of Transportation is procuring registrar services to maintain the Federal Aviation Administration's certifications in ISO 14001 and 45001 at the Mike Monroney Aeronautical Center. Key requirements include providing the necessary services to ensure compliance with these international standards.
